Description

Magnificent bowl with fire-gilded bronze fittings, Meissen, around 1745, painting probably Augustin Dietze (1696-1769) (see Lit.Anderson Collection No. 67 in Allen: 18th Century Meissen Porcelain, 1988), probably from the property of Marie Countess von Taubenheim, fine Painting with gallantry scenes, gold decoration, bottom mark, mouth edge bumped and restored, 15x20.5x18 cm
